326818038426800893266679066
Even
326818038426800893266679066 is even
Previous even number is 326818038426800893266679064
Next even number is 326818038426800893266679068
Cubed
34907444567717280683313437313144874533995266060489808187235808911552478079459496
Squared
Binary
10000111001010110011010010101110100001101101001001010110111101011000100101101010100011010